Yes they can report you. I have been reported before. If someone writes down your plates, they can call the police and complain. But the police really won't do anything...actually they can't unless the RP officially wants to file a formal complaint or make a [citizen's] arrest. But the police won't take action on their own because they were not present at the time. Of course, this is only for certain "crimes", particularly traffic infractions, etc. The State Police sent me a letter saying "a motorist observed your vehicle driving erratically..." yada yada yada and quoted the complaintant as saying "he exited the freeway at a high rate of speed..." ending the letter with this is an "unofficial" notice and that there was no requirement for me to respond because nothing will go on my record.
